How to implement a parametric sweep with a time dependent study step

Please login with a confirmed email address before reporting spam

Hi all,

I have a simple microfluidic transport model, where I simulate laminar flow of water in a microchannel network with transport of a dilute species. I've tried to implement a parametric sweep of one of my inlet flow rates (a parameter named 'Vf' specified at the top left inlet boundary of my geometry) with a time dependent study step. However, every time I run the model I get an error stating that 'Parameter list gives empty sweep'. Strangely, this sweep works if I disable the time dependent step and instead solve for the stationary solution of my laminar flow physics node. I should also add that I'm using two physics modules with this model, solving for the steady state flow profile thought the channel network and solving for the time dependent solution for the concentration profile of a solute traveling through the network from the top-left inlet boundary. I've attached the model. I'd greatly appreciate any help you're able to provide with this.
